Special Occasion Strawberry Vinaigrette Recipe
This fresh spring variation on raspberry vinaigrette makes a low-fat, high-taste topping for salads. Let it elevate a salad into a special-occasion meal by serving it over Red Sails lettuce, grated carrots, chickpeas, green onions, and raisins — topped with strawberry slices — as shown.
